Why I started Mobĕliz
I’ve spent two decades inside the sales software industry working with category creators and category disruptors alike. From Siebel Systems, to Salesforce, to Vlocity, I’ve seen how these systems are built, sold, and deployed.
What changed over the years wasn’t the model it was the packaging.
Nearly every CRM system still operates on the same underlying assumption: humans should adapt to software. Data entry before outcomes. Forms before thinking. Configuration before momentum. Thirty years later, we’re still asking salespeople to behave like database administrators.
Legacy tools like Act! Software never truly evolved. Enterprise platforms became bloated and expensive, requiring armies to implement. And small businesses were left paying perpetual rent for systems designed for a different era.
Mobĕliz exists to reverse that equation.
I believe work should start with language not forms. With intent not schema. With outcomes not busywork. Mobĕliz is built around a simple idea: software should understand how people actually work, and then do the heavy lifting on their behalf.

The Problem We're Solving
The problem isn’t just legacy software, it’s legacy thinking.
Forms-based systems force people to translate real conversations into rigid data structures. SaaS business models lock customers into subscriptions whether the software improves or not. Together, they’ve produced a generation of tools that optimize for reporting, not results.
Act! was built for the 1980s. SaaS platforms were built for the 2000s. But today’s work happens in real time, across conversations, email, and context not nested forms and required fields.
Mobĕliz is built for now.
Our platform uses natural language and generative AI so you can describe what happened, what you need, or what comes next and the system takes it from there. No wrestling with rigid workflows. No fighting required fields. No brittle logic hard-coded into last decade’s assumptions.
